What is Conveyancing?

Conveyancing in Cheltenham is the legal process of transferring ownership of a property from one person to another.

  • Contract preparation and review
  • Property searches and title checks
  • Handling finances and settlements
  • Preparing and registering the transfer of ownership

Do I Need a Conveyancer?

While it’s technically possible to handle conveyancing yourself, it’s highly recommended to engage a qualified conveyancer. They possess in-depth knowledge of property law and can handle the complexities efficiently, saving you time and potential legal issues.

How Much Does Conveyancing Cost?

Conveyancing fees vary depending on the property's value, location, and the complexity of the transaction. Generally, costs include:

  • Conveyancer's fees
  • Government charges (transfer duty, stamp duty)
  • Search fees
  • Mortgage registration fees

How Long Does Conveyancing Take?

The timeframe for conveyancing can fluctuate based on various factors, including property type, loan approval, and any unforeseen issues. Typically, it takes anywhere from 4 to 6 weeks to complete the process.

What Happens if There Are Problems with the Property?

A thorough property search is conducted to identify potential issues like title disputes, building permits, or outstanding debts. If problems arise, your conveyancer will advise you on the necessary steps to resolve them.

Can I Sell My Property Myself?

Yes, you can sell your property privately. However, engaging a real estate agent can streamline the process and potentially attract a wider pool of buyers. Regardless of the selling method, you'll still need a conveyancer to handle the legal aspects.

What Happens at Settlement?

Settlement is the final stage of the conveyancing process when ownership is transferred. All financial matters, including the payment of the purchase price and discharge of any existing mortgage, are finalized on this day.

The Value of Consulting a Criminal Defence Attorney

In the beginning of the proceedings whatever you say will be investigated as soon as law enforcement contacts you regarding a charge lodged against you. This can take the shape of a formal interview in a police station or a field interview that is often recorded on a body-worn camera.

Criminal defence attorneys have had years of training and study to enable them to properly evaluate the evidence and determine if a defence is warranted. A skilled criminal defence attorney might swiftly dismantle a case that seems to be built against you.

Understanding the Proceedings Against You Can Be Helped by a Criminal Defence Attorney

Understanding what has been asked of you and what is expected of you might be difficult at times. Your criminal defence attorney may help you comprehend the allegations against you by laying out the elements that the prosecution must show, any viable defences, and the possible length of the sentence.
